Summary
This PR acts on the resolved solution from #3378. In #3288, we changed Ruff to avoid flagging unused import in
ModuleNotFoundError
blocks, like:This is a common pattern used to detect module availability, and removing those imports tends to break code.
However, these imports are unused, and it's confusing that Ruff doesn't flag them. Further, this isn't the recommended way to test for module availability -- we have
importlib
APIs for that.So this PR modifies the logic to (1) flag unused imports in blocks like the above, but (2) avoid autofixing them, and (3) using a dedicated message to point the user to those
importlib
APIs.Closes #3378.
